Rev 9628 | Rev 9645 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 9628 | Rev 9630 | ||
---|---|---|---|
Line 49... | Line 49... | ||
49 | END; |
49 | END; |
Line 50... | Line 50... | ||
50 | 50 | ||
Line 51... | Line 51... | ||
51 | 51 | ||
52 | VAR |
52 | VAR |
53 | 53 | ||
54 | paint *: PROCEDURE (eb: tEditBox); |
54 | draw *: PROCEDURE (eb: tEditBox); |
Line 122... | Line 122... | ||
122 | VAR |
122 | VAR |
123 | Lib: INTEGER; |
123 | Lib: INTEGER; |
124 | BEGIN |
124 | BEGIN |
125 | Lib := KOSAPI.LoadLib("/sys/lib/box_lib.obj"); |
125 | Lib := KOSAPI.LoadLib("/sys/lib/box_lib.obj"); |
126 | ASSERT(Lib # 0); |
126 | ASSERT(Lib # 0); |
127 | GetProc(Lib, SYSTEM.ADR(paint), "edit_box_draw"); |
127 | GetProc(Lib, SYSTEM.ADR(draw), "edit_box_draw"); |
128 | GetProc(Lib, SYSTEM.ADR(key), "edit_box_key_safe"); |
128 | GetProc(Lib, SYSTEM.ADR(key), "edit_box_key_safe"); |
129 | GetProc(Lib, SYSTEM.ADR(mouse), "edit_box_mouse"); |
129 | GetProc(Lib, SYSTEM.ADR(mouse), "edit_box_mouse"); |
130 | GetProc(Lib, SYSTEM.ADR(_setValue), "edit_box_set_text"); |
130 | GetProc(Lib, SYSTEM.ADR(_setValue), "edit_box_set_text"); |
131 | END main; |
131 | END main; |